What to know about ZIP 91962

ZIP code 91962 covers Pine Valley, CA in San Diego County with a population of about 2,457.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 57.6 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area codes 619, 858; U.S. House district CA-48; the SAN DIEGO media market.

Income and economy in Pine Valley, CA

Median household income in ZIP 91962 is about $140,270 — about 87% above the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 7.9%; unemployment rate near 22.4%; 41.0%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 7.3 points above the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Education, Wholesale trade, and Retail trade; about 28.7%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 13.5 points above the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 180.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 91962

Median home value is about $496,800 — about 43% above the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show median gross rent around $2,200 (about 89% above the U.S. median rent ($1,163)), and owner-occupancy near 92.6% (about 27.2 points above the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).

To comfortably buy a median-priced home in ZIP 91962 in Pine Valley, CA, a household would need roughly $137,000 in annual income under a 20% down, 30-year loan at 6.8% (illustrative), keeping housing costs near 28% of income. Estimated monthly PITI is about $3,191. That is roughly in line with the local median household income ($140,270). Rates, taxes, insurance, and HOA fees vary — treat this as a planning estimate, not a lender quote.

Climate risk and migration signals

FEMA’s National Risk Index rates natural-hazard risk for Pine Valley CDP, CA as Very High (composite score 99.7), which is among the highest nationally. The strongest component scores on US5 are wildfire (100.0) and flood (99.7). These scores are county-linked NRI values published for planning context — all ZIP codes in the same county share the same composite score on US5. Useful when comparing insurance and disaster exposure across areas, not a substitute for a parcel-level flood or fire determination.

Climate normals for Pine Valley CDP, CA show little to no average snow and around 12.6 inches of annual precipitation.

IRS migration statistics show a net inflow of about 121 for ZIP 91962 (Pine Valley CDP, CA) on US5’s published series — a signal of people/tax filers moving in relative to those leaving. Inflows often track job growth, housing demand, or lifestyle migration; treat the figure as a directional indicator rather than a precise headcount.
